The Valkyrie will be the legacy of Red Bull F1’s Chief Technical Officer Adrain Newey, whose remit was building “a piece of art”, yet something fierce and powerful - this car brings F1 performance to the road. A very limited run of 150 road cars will be produced with the Cosworth 6.5 litre naturally aspirated engine producing 1130hp. At a rumoured price of £2.7m + taxes there was an extensive list of disappointed buyers who were not lucky enough to be selected.
Project One Hypercar is the first road production car to be built with a Formula One engine, but only 275 lucky owners will get to own a piece of motoring history. At a cost of €2.275m + taxes, it buys you over 1000hp and 0-62 in under 2.5 seconds, not to mention exceeding 220 mph! Whilst the car hasn’t yet been built, they are already changing hands with up to a €1m premium.
La Ferrari Aperta boasts the ultimate in open top driving. Ferrari produced 499 of the Coupé, but only 210 of the Aperta. They are both powered by the 6.3 Litre v12 engine with F1 Kers technology, boosting the car to 950hp. Return on investment has been particularly impressive, with clients benefitting from an average of 150% profit on both cars.
